That is kinda my point Some brands you hardly ever get to ride and some you hardly ever need to fix. The titans need fixed almost every ride and the joyners hardly ever need anything fixed. But people call them all 250s and assume they are all the same. I think the 150s karts where more similar and people got used to 150 being pretty much like any other. But in the 250 catagory even brand names dont help because people like roketa, sunl, and some others made several different designs some of which were pretty good and some of which were garbage.
